Twilight Land is a collection of stories written and illustrated by Howard Pyle (1853 -1911), and published in book form in 1894.
It is evening at the Inn of the Sign of Mother Goose. In a dark, smoky room, the world's most famous storytellers gather to weave tales of mystery and enchantment. In this collection of 16 haunting fairy tales, Howard Pyle intertwines each story with the next, creating a world filled with princes and demons, genies and sorceresses.
Howard Pyle is most noted for his illustration. Considered by many to be the Father of American Illustration, his career began in 1876 and continued till 1911.
